本次研究生入学英语考试的完形填空部分原文摘自《科学美国人》网站,原文标题是"How Humor Makes You Friendlier, Sexier" (幽默感为什么能让你看来更友善性感,点击此处查看原文>>),是一篇标准的科学说明类型文章。下面就请大家对照原题和我们一起来看看这篇文章:
        Read the following text. Choose the best word(s) for each numbered blank and mark [A], [B], [C] or [D] on ANSWER SHEET 1. (10 points)
        Ancient Greek philosopher Aristotle viewed laughter as “a bodily exercise precious to health.” But ­­­__1___some claims to the contrary, laughing probably has little influence on physical fitness. Laughter does __2___short-term changes in the function of the heart and its blood vessels, ___3_ heart rate and oxygen consumption But because hard laughter is difficult to __4__, a good laugh is unlikely to have __5___ benefits the way, say, walking or jogging does.
        __6__, instead of straining muscles to build them, as exercise does, laughter apparently accomplishes the __7__, studies dating back to the 1930’s indicate that laughter__8___ muscles, decreasing muscle tone for up to 45 minutes after the laugh dies down.
        Such bodily reaction might conceivably help _9__the effects of psychological stress. Anyway, the act of laughing probably does produce other types of ___10___ feedback, that improve an individual’s emotional state. __11____one classical theory of emotion, our feelings are partially rooted ____12___ physical reactions. It was argued at the end of the 19th century that humans do not cry ___13___they are sad but they become sad when the tears begin to flow.
        Although sadness also ____14___ tears, evidence suggests that emotions can flow __15___ muscular responses. In an experiment published in 1988,social psychologist Fritz Strack of the University of würzburg in Germany asked volunteers to __16___ a pen either with their teeth-thereby creating an artificial smile – or with their lips, which would produce a(n) __17___ expression. Those forced to exercise their smiling muscles ___18___ more exuberantly to funny cartoons than did those whose mouths were contracted in a frown, ____19___ that expressions may influence emotions rather than just the other way around. ___20__ , the physical act of laughter could improve mood.
        1.[A]among       [B]except        [C]despite       [D]like
        2.[A]reflect       [B]demand       [C]indicate       [D]produce
        3.[A]stabilizing    [B]boosting       [C]impairing     [D]determining
        4.[A]transmit      [B]sustain        [C]evaluate      [D]observe
        5.[A]measurable   [B]manageable    [C]affordable     [D]renewable
        6.[A]In turn       [B]In fact        [C]In addition     [D]In brief
        7.[A]opposite     [B]impossible     [C]average       [D]expected
        8.[A]hardens      [B]weakens       [C]tightens      [D]relaxes
        9.[A]aggravate     [B]generate       [C]moderate     [D]enhance
        10.[A]physical     [B]mental        [C]subconscious  [D]internal
        11.[A]Except for   [B]According to   [C]Due to        [D]As for
        12.[A]with        [B]on           [C]in           [D]at
        13.[A]unless      [B]until          [C]if           [D]because
        14.[A]exhausts    [B]follows        [C]precedes     [D]suppresses
        15.[A]into        [B]from          [C]towards      [D]beyond
        16.[A]fetch        [B]bite          [C]pick        [D]hold
        17.[A]disappointed  [B]excited       [C]joyful       [D]indifferent
        18.[A]adapted      [B]catered       [C]turned       [D]reacted
        19.[A]suggesting    [B]requiring     [C]mentioning   [D]supposing
        20.[A]Eventually    [B]Consequently  [C]Similarly    [D]Conversely
        【标准答案】
        1.[C]despite   从后面一个句子中的little我们可以判断出这里的转折意为,因而本题选择despite;
        2.[D]produce   此处前一个词does表示强调,根据上下文课意思可判断选项;
        3.[B]boosting  boost意思是促进增进、stabilize意思是稳定、impair是减少削弱、determine意思是决定。因而可以判断选boost;
        4.[B]sustain   本题全凭词义选择:transmit 意思是传输;sustain,维持;evaluate,评估;observe,观察。
        5.[A]measurable  本题一样是词义考察:measurable,可评估的;manageable,可掌握的;affordable,可承受的;renewable,可更新的。
        6.[B]In fact   从后一句中的Instead of doing...可以看出此处有意群的转换,因而选择了"In fact",实际上……起到承前启后的作用。
        7.[A]opposite   从前一句的 instead of 得知此处句意发生转折,因而选择opposite
        8.[D]relaxes   从后一句"decreasing muscle tone",减少肌肉张力,可判断此处应选择relaxes,放松。
        9.[C]moderate  也是从上一句的句意“放松肌肉、减少肌肉张力”可看出此处的意思应该相同,因而选择"moderate",稳定、减轻。
        10.[A]physical  还是词义考察,同学们可以从这道题看出出题老师对形近字、意近字有多爱了吧…… physical,身体上的;mental,精神上的(这是一对,一定要记住!);subconscious,潜意识的;internal,内在的。
        小编分享一个做题的“非官方方法”给大家:当选项中出现明显的成对、或反义词时,那么答案多半在其中。也就是我们可以从做一个四选一的题,变成做二选一的题。那就算是猜、正确率也有50%了吧!?
        11.[B]According to    后一句提到"one classical theory of emotion",一个经典情感理论,说明是距离。所以此处连接词选择"According to"。
        12.[C]in   这题的考点是介词和动词的搭配,如果你明白前一个root是“根、扎根”的意思,那么基本可以排除选项中的with,那到底是on, at 或是 in,就看日常积累了。
        13.[D]because  这整句的意思是:“在19世纪末期有这样的争论:人们不是因为悲伤而哭泣,而是因为当流泪时会变得悲伤。” 因而此处选择表示因果关系的because。其他的until,直到;unless,除非;if,如果,都不符合。
        14.[C]precedes   词义又来:exhaust,精疲力尽;follow,跟随;precede,在……之前;suppress,抑制。
        15.[B]from  从动词flow,流动,来判断。
        16.[D]hold  因为后一句提到“thereby creating an artificial smile”,从而创造一个虚假的笑脸。可以看出,无论是fetch或是pick(都是取来、捡来的意思)都是不对的,bite(咬)更不对。要维持一个笑脸,所以用"hold"。
        17.[A]disappointed  这道题的技巧在于,无论是excited, joyful 或是indifferent,它们所能传达的面部表情都是类似的,因而得知选disappointed,失望的——得出不一样的表情。
        18.[D]reacted  词义题:adapt,适应;cater,迎合;turn,转变;react,反应、
        19.[A]suggesting   词义题:suggest,传达了、证明了;require,要求;mention,提到;suppose,假设。
        这里整句话的意思是:面对搞笑卡通,那些被要求做笑脸的人比起那些被要求皱眉的人表现得更有生气。从而证明了不单单是情绪影响表情、表情也可以影响情绪。
       
        20.[C]Similarly   从上一句的翻译大家可以看出,"the physical act of laughter could improve mood."(笑这个生理动作可以改善情绪),这个意思是和上一句一样的。所以应该选择similar,相同的。而不是其他三个选项。
        (本文真题部分由万学海文提供、答案及解析由沪江英语提供)
